<h3>Overview</h3>
<p>L-Arginine is a semi-essential amino acid produced via enzymatic hydrolysis or microbial fermentation. Its <strong>molecular formula</strong> is C6H14N4O2 and <strong>CAS number</strong> is 74-79-3.</p>
<h3>Application</h3>
<ul>
<li><strong>Nutrition:</strong> Dietary supplement for muscle recovery and immune support.</li>
<li><strong>Pharmaceuticals:</strong> Raw material for vasodilator drugs and nitric oxide precursors.</li>
<li><strong>Feed Additives:</strong> Enhances protein synthesis in livestock and aquaculture.</li>
</ul>
<h3>Precautions</h3>
<p>Store in cool, dry places below 25°C to prevent degradation. Clinical use requires dosage control for renal patients due to nitrogen load risks.</p>
